Police are looking for tips in the Alsinia Raub in the city center of Ansonia

Ansonia, CT – The police are looking for the public to solve a weekend robbery in East Main Street, which was caught on video.

The incident occurred on Saturday at 11:40 p.m., the police said in a Facebook post on Monday.

A man told the police that he had a car accident, and then the driver of the other car began to shout him, and then took his wallet and phone. The man was not injured during the robbery, the police said.

Wayne Williams, chief of police from Ansonia, said the department received numerous tips and pursued it.

According to Williams, a video of the incident was brought into circulation on social media.

“We would encourage people not to share this video that repeats the victim in this case and sensationalized the ridiculous actions of those involved,” said Williams.

Williams said there were several people outdoors at that time, but nobody called the police or helped the victim.

“Instead of asking this robbery of a defenseless victim to video, responsible citizens should call 911,” said Williams. “We are better than that.”
